Quarterly Planning Note — Supplier Renewal

Board summary: the Ardveck Components contract expires at quarter-end. Recommendation is a two-year renewal with a 4% price concession secured during negotiations. Alternative bids from Solmere Industrial were competitive but carry switching risk at the Caulden facility. Legal review is complete; signature targeted within three weeks. Capital impact is neutral against plan. Approval requested at the next session. Strategic context appears in the note below.

board note of baweg-bawig: Project Tamath slips by six weeks because of the audit delay.

## Step 4: Swap in the tile cache

Okay, this is the fun part. Pointmire's new tile-rendering cache sits between the renderer and object storage, so stale tiles stop hammering the raster workers. Drain the old LRU process first — don't just kill it, or you'll get half-written tiles lingering for days. Once drained, restart the render pool so it picks up the cache endpoints. Then apply the cache layer's configuration values shown here.

deployment values, bagag-bawig:
DRUVAN_PIN=0740
DRUVAN_TENANT=wendor
DRUVAN_METRICS_HOST=metrics.druvan.tolvaqnet.example
DRUVAN_SEAL=seal_75cd0b2d
DRUVAN_STANDBY_TEAM=tamael

# Cold Storage Archiving — Who to Contact

Archiving of Frostbin cold storage buckets is handled by the Glacier Ops rotation at Umbra Systems. Do not archive buckets yourself. File a request ticket with bucket name, retention class, and owner team. Turnaround is two business days. Legal-hold buckets require sign-off from Records first. For anything urgent or ambiguous, email the rotation directly.

alerts address for yajof-kahog: eliax@qirvanlabs.corp